Section 3 - Configuration PPTP Choose this Internet connection if your ISP provides you PPTP account. After modifying any settings, click Save Settings to save your changes. Address Mode: Choose Static IP only if your ISP assigns you an IP address. Otherwise, please choose Dynamic IP. PPTP IP Address: Enter the information provided by your ISP. (Only applicable for Static IP PPTP.) PPTP Subnet Mask: Enter the information provided by your ISP. (Only applicable for Static IP PPTP.) PPTP Gateway IP Enter the information provided by your ISP. Address: (Only applicable for Static IP PPTP.) PPTP Server IP IP address of PPTP server. Address: Username: User/account name that your ISP provides to you for PPTP dial-up. Password: Password that your ISP provides to you for PPTP dial-up. Verify Password: Fill in with the same password in Password field. Reconnect Mode: Choose Always-on when you want to establish PPTP connection all the time. If you choose Connect-on-demand, the device will establish PPTP connection when local users want to surf Internet, and disconnect if no traffic after time period of Maximum Idle Time. Maximum Idle Time: The time of no activity to disconnect your PPTP session. Set it to zero or choose Always-on to disable this feature. D-Link DWR-512 User Manual 17
